前提・実現したいこと
ここに質問の内容を詳しく書いてください。
Rを用いて、twitterからテキストマイニングを行っています。
期間指定をしようとして、データを取り出したいのですが、以下のエラーメッセージが発生しました。
発生している問題・エラーメッセージ
比較 (5) はアトミックおよびリスト型に対してだけ可能です
i Input ..1
is timestamp >= as.Date("2016-01-01")
.
Run rlang::last_error()
to see where the error occurred.
該当のソースコード
##library(lubridate)は読み込んでいます
tw_data <- search_tweets("胃潰瘍", n = 10000, include_rts = FALSE)
tw_time <- tw_data[["created_at"]] %>%
as.POSIXct(tz = "Etc/GMT") %>%
as.POSIXlt(tz = "Japan")
tw_data <- tw_data %>%
filter(timestamp >= as.Date("2016-01-01"),
timestamp >= as.Date("2017-01-01"))
試したこと
rlang::last_error()を見てみましたが、
i Input ..1
is timestamp >= as.Date("2016-01-01")
.
Backtrace:
2. dplyr::filter(...)
17. dplyr:::h(simpleError(msg, call))
と表示されて、どうしたらよいかわかりませんでした。
補足情報(FW/ツールのバージョンなど)
ここにより詳細な情報を記載してください。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2021/03/11 10:31